I was so excited all last week about attending the show that I could hardly sit still, you can only imagine my elation when we arrived at Elstree and were not only at the very front of the crowd outside the Big brother house, but also given passes to join the actual studio audience for the eviction interview.

First of all I should probably mention that in preparation for the event, Grainne (the one in the gold cardy), Oonagh (the one in the hat) and I, spent the afternoon in the pub, drinking wine and preparing our signs. We spent the first hour despairing of our terrible lack of wit, but as the wine flowed, inspiration hit and out came the highlighters! It all sounds like great fun, but when we eventually rolled out of the pub and into the queue, the bladder situation got a bit frantic and suddenly the three bottles of wine seemed like a bit of a mistake.

On entering the Big Brother complex, we got ridiculously excited by the fact that we could hear the fake crowd noise being streamed into the house and also by the sight of the top few leaves of some trees from the housemates garden. We almost couldn’t breath when we caught our first glimpse of Davina running past, and by the time the live show started I was screaming like a teenager.

Half way through the show we were moved into the Big Brother studio. Unfortunately the security was quite tight inside and we weren’t really supposed to have cameras in there. We got one or two quick shots, but didn’t want to run the risk of getting thrown out.

We managed to get into the first row of the audience. We were so close to the chairs that we could have touched Davina. Had I been male I might have tried to do that as the woman looks even more stunning in real life! The floor manager warned us that when Davina came into the studio to announce which housemate would be evicted we were to remain perfectly silent, so as not to give them any indication of what the public’s opinions were on the nominees. Of course as soon as Davina called Belinda’s name, we got carried away and started to clap. We stopped after three claps and then panicked in case we were evicted along with big B.

After Belinda battled the crowds and the press photographers, she came into the studio and gave us a little private concert before her interview began. I have to say, though I was not overly impressed with Belinda (Belinda Belinda) inside the house, she came across amazingly well during her interview and seemed so genuine and down to earth, even when the cameras weren’t rolling.

So the interview eventually ended and we were getting ready to leave when some of the producers asked if we would like to stay and help them with filming a fake Big Brother eviction for a Channel 4 drama which will be aired later this year. Needless to say I jumped at the chance.

We traipsed back outside and joined the main audience once more, where we told that the crew would be filming a fake BB eviction but we were to respond and react as if it was all real. We stood right beneath the infamous stairs as we watched a blonde girl enter the Big Brother doors, then minutes later Davina evicted her as if she was a normal housemate. We boo’ed and chanted more than we had during the real eviction, and watched as ‘Pippa’ made her way through the crowd, down the runway supposedly to her eviction interview. It was all a bit surreal, but strangely exciting, and I can’t wait to watch the finished product on TV this autumn.
